leading general performance Requirements for Solar cleansing robotic Batteries
Solar cleansing robots demand from customers a battery solution that delivers constant effectiveness and longevity. superior-capability Lithium Batteries are critical to make sure prolonged operational time, permitting the robotic to clean a bigger surface area location on a single cost. pounds is usually a major variable, as lighter batteries improve the robotic’s maneuverability and cut down wear and tear on the cleaning mechanism. In addition, these batteries require to resist harsh environmental circumstances, which includes Intense temperatures, dust, and humidity. quick charging abilities are also essential to reduce downtime and maximize efficiency. a strong Battery administration technique (BMS) is critical to prevent overcharging, deep discharging, and overheating, making sure the safety and longevity with the battery.
evaluating Lithium Battery Technologies for Automated Solar upkeep
many lithium battery systems can be found, Every with its personal advantages and disadvantages. Lithium Iron Phosphate (LiFePO4) batteries are noted for their fantastic safety, very long lifespan, and thermal balance, earning them ideal for demanding apps like photo voltaic cleaning robots. Lithium-ion (Li-ion) batteries offer superior Strength density but may well have to have additional advanced thermal management programs. Lithium Polymer (LiPo) batteries are lightweight and will be molded into several designs, but They are really usually a lot less long lasting and also have a shorter lifespan than LiFePO4 batteries. When deciding on a battery technological innovation, think about the certain running disorders, performance demands, and safety issues of your solar cleaning robot. LiFePO4 often emerges as the preferred alternative resulting from its harmony of performance, protection, and longevity.
